Macro Comparison Table

Macro Gatorade Tomato Difference
Calories 140 cal 22 cal +536% Gatorade
Protein 0g 1.1g -100% Gatorade
Carbs 34g 4.8g +608% Gatorade
Fat 0g 0.2g -100% Gatorade

Differences shown relative to Gatorade. Positive = Gatorade has more.

Quick Take

Gatorade delivers 140 calories per serving with 0g protein, 34g carbs, and 0g fat. Tomato delivers 22 calories with 1.1g protein, 4.8g carbs, and 0.2g fat. The most meaningful difference: Tomato saves 118 calories per serving — meaningful over a week of meals. Both deliver similar protein density.
